hadolint
A linter for Dockerfiles.
Backend: pants.backend.docker.lint.hadolint
Config section: [hadolint]

Advanced options
config
--hadolint-config=<file_option>PANTS_HADOLINT_CONFIG[hadolint]
config = <file_option>
NonePath to an YAML config file understood by Hadolint (https://github.com/hadolint/hadolint#configure).
Setting this option will disable [hadolint].config_discovery. Use this option if the config is located in a non-standard location.
config_discovery
--[no-]hadolint-config-discoveryPANTS_HADOLINT_CONFIG_DISCOVERY[hadolint]
config_discovery = <bool>
TrueIf true, Pants will include all relevant config files during runs (.hadolint.yaml and .hadolint.yml).
Use [hadolint].config instead if your config is in a non-standard location.

Known versions to verify downloads against.
Each element is a pipe-separated string of version|platform|sha256|length or
version|platform|sha256|length|url_override, where:
versionis the version stringplatformis one of[linux_arm64,linux_x86_64,macos_arm64,macos_x86_64]sha256is the 64-character hex representation of the expected sha256 digest of the download file, as emitted byshasum -a 256lengthis the expected length of the download file in bytes, as emitted bywc -c- (Optional)
url_overrideis a specific url to use instead of the normally generated url for this version
E.g., 3.1.2|macos_x86_64|6d0f18cd84b918c7b3edd0203e75569e0c7caecb1367bbbe409b44e28514f5be|42813.
and 3.1.2|macos_arm64 |aca5c1da0192e2fd46b7b55ab290a92c5f07309e7b0ebf4e45ba95731ae98291|50926|https://example.mac.org/bin/v3.1.2/mac-aarch64-v3.1.2.tgz.
Values are space-stripped, so pipes can be indented for readability if necessary.
url_platform_mapping
--hadolint-url-platform-mapping="{'key1': val1, 'key2': val2, ...}"PANTS_HADOLINT_URL_PLATFORM_MAPPING[hadolint.url_platform_mapping]
key1 = val1
key2 = val2
...
{
"linux_arm64": "Linux-arm64",
"linux_x86_64": "Linux-x86_64",
"macos_arm64": "Darwin-x86_64",
"macos_x86_64": "Darwin-x86_64"
}A dictionary mapping platforms to strings to be used when generating the URL to download the tool.
In --url-template, anytime the {platform} string is used, Pants will determine the current platform, and substitute {platform} with the respective value from your dictionary.
For example, if you define {"macos_x86_64": "apple-darwin", "linux_x86_64": "unknown-linux"}, and run Pants on Linux with an intel architecture, then {platform} will be substituted in the --url-template option with unknown-linux.
url_template
--hadolint-url-template=<str>PANTS_HADOLINT_URL_TEMPLATE[hadolint]
url_template = <str>
https://github.com/hadolint/hadolint/releases/download/{version}/hadolint-{platform}URL to download the tool, either as a single binary file or a compressed file (e.g. zip file). You can change this to point to your own hosted file, e.g. to work with proxies or for access via the filesystem through a file:$abspath URL (e.g. file:/this/is/absolute, possibly by templating the buildroot in a config file).
Use {version} to have the value from --version substituted, and {platform} to have a value from --url-platform-mapping substituted in, depending on the current platform. For example, https://github.com/.../protoc-{version}-{platform}.zip.
